19 Preset
Recalling any state, including the user preset state, affects the conditions of more
parameters than are affected by a factory preset. For example, external preamp gain and
input impedance correction are not affected by a factory preset but are affected by a user
preset.
Key Path: Front-panel key
Dependencies/Couplings: Depends on the preset type (user, mode or factory) setting in
the System, Power On/Preset keys.
SCPI Status Bits/OPC Dependencies: Clears all pending OPC bits. The status byte is
set to 0.
Remote Command:
:SYSTem:PRESet
Remote Command Notes:
The SYSTem:PRESet command immediately presets the instrument state to values
dependent on the preset type that is currently selected (FACTory, USER, MODE).
SYSTem:PRESet does not reset “persistent” functions such as IP address, time/date
display style, or auto-alignment state to their factory defaults. Use
SYSTem:PRESet:PERSistent. See “Restore Sys Defaults" on page 498.
SYSTem:PRESet:TYPE sets the type of preset.
Example:
:SYST:PRES:TYPE MODE sets the preset mode type to mode. See “Preset Type" on
page 478.
:SYST:PRES presets the instrument to the currently selected preset type.
